Our activity was for the class to read an article and select a phrase within it that really stuck out to them. They then had to read that phrase over and over in a different way each time. They were then placed into groups to conduct a poem with each member’s phrase. I really enjoyed hearing all the different poems that came out of this activity and I could definitely see myself using this activity in my own classroom later on.
